A 17-year-old North Philadelphia high school student was arrested after police say he brought a handgun and narcotics to school on Monday.
What we know:
Officers from the Philadelphia Police Department were called to Thomas Alva Edison High School on West Luzerne Street just before 9 a.m. Monday.
Police say a 17-year-old student was found with a silver handgun and narcotics.
